Transaction 12fdfed7176603f4e19fbebbee2eac05460ed0e7945d92c113755e6603e71282

1 Input
2 Outputs
  • 12fdfed7176603f4e19fbebbee2eac05460ed0e7945d92c113755e6603e71282:0
  • value  1838539158
    address  3H4ibL6ba6ihmRWNhP6ZhF9rGuwGyejBVT
  • 12fdfed7176603f4e19fbebbee2eac05460ed0e7945d92c113755e6603e71282:1
  • value  3978000
    address  1PRAWqhLrS2ohGjnRugRJT3MbSamrj4bVF